Bitcoin Slides Toward $62,000 as Trump’s Strait of Hormuz Comments Rattle Markets
Bitcoin extended its losses on Monday as broader financial markets reacted nervously to fresh comments from President Donald Trump regarding the Strait of Hormuz. Btc slipped closer to $62,000 during Wall Street's opening hours, tracking a wider selloff in risk assets. US stock indexes also opened lower, with the Nasdaq Composite down around 1% at the time.

Trump Signals US Control Over Key Oil Route
Speaking in a television interview, Trump said the United States intends to take charge of the Strait of Hormuz, a critical route for global oil shipments that Iran shut down over the weekend. He described the move as the US becoming a kind of guardian over the strait, adding that the country should be compensated for taking on that role. Oil prices held firm following the remarks, with US crude trading near $75 per barrel.

Heavy Short Selling Pressures Bitcoin Lower
Traders pointed to aggressive short positioning as a key driver behind bitcoin’s drop. One analyst noted that price action settled right at a widely watched volume based support level, calling it a critical point for buyers to defend. Another market watcher separately flagged unusually heavy short activity alongside rising open interest, suggesting bearish bets were building quickly even as spot selling added to the pressure.
Some Traders Still Expect a Bounce Back
Despite the weak short term picture, certain analysts maintain that bitcoin could still recover toward the $70,000 to $75,000 range. Supporters of this view pointed to signs of selling exhaustion in momentum indicators, along with data suggesting spot buying has outpaced selling in recent sessions. According to this outlook, a rebound remains a matter of timing rather than certainty being in question.
